Understanding Mechanical Kitchen Scales

Mechanical kitchen scales, also known as analog scales, utilize a spring mechanism to measure weight. Unlike digital scales, they don’t require batteries and offer a tactile, straightforward approach to weighing ingredients. These scales are favored for their durability and simplicity, making them a staple in many kitchens.

Key Components of a Mechanical Kitchen Scale

Familiarizing yourself with the main parts of the scale is crucial for accurate readings:

  • Weighing Platform: The flat surface where ingredients are placed.
  • Dial Face: Displays the weight measurement, usually in grams or ounces.
  • Pointer: Indicates the weight on the dial.
  • Zeroing Knob: Allows calibration of the scale to ensure accurate readings.

Step-by-Step Guide to Using a Mechanical Kitchen Scale

Follow these steps to effectively use your mechanical kitchen scale:

  1. Place the Scale on a Flat Surface: Ensure the scale is on a stable, level surface to prevent inaccurate readings.
  2. Zero the Scale: Before weighing, place the empty container or bowl on the scale. Adjust the zeroing knob until the pointer aligns with the zero mark on the dial. Tap the container gently to settle the scale.
  3. Add Ingredients: Gradually add the ingredient to the container. Observe the pointer’s movement on the dial to determine the weight.
  4. Read the Measurement: Once the pointer stabilizes, read the weight indicated on the dial. Ensure you account for the container’s weight if not tared.

Tips for Accurate Measurements

To achieve precise readings with your mechanical kitchen scale:

  • Use a Level Surface: Always place the scale on a flat, stable surface to ensure accurate measurements.
  • Calibrate Regularly: Periodically check and adjust the zeroing knob to maintain accuracy.
  • Weigh Ingredients Directly: Whenever possible, place ingredients directly on the scale to avoid discrepancies caused by containers.
  • Handle with Care: Avoid dropping or mishandling the scale, as mechanical components can be sensitive to shocks.

Maintenance and Care

Proper maintenance ensures the longevity and accuracy of your mechanical kitchen scale:

  • Clean Regularly: Wipe the scale with a damp cloth to remove dust and residues. Avoid using harsh chemicals that could damage the surface.
  • Store Properly: Keep the scale in a dry, cool place when not in use. Protect it from extreme temperatures and humidity.
  • Check Calibration: Regularly verify the scale’s calibration to ensure consistent accuracy.
